文件转byte[]

byte[] pB = null;
if (!string.IsNullOrEmpty(pathword))//pathword文件路径
{

     FileStream p = null;
     try
      {
           p = new FileStream(pathword, FileMode.Open, FileAccess.Read);
           BinaryReader br = new BinaryReader(p);
           br.BaseStream.Seek(0, SeekOrigin.Begin);
           pB = br.ReadBytes((int)br.BaseStream.Length);
       }
       catc
       {
            pB = null;
       }
       finally
       {
            if (p != null)
            {
                 p.Close();
            }
        }
}

 

posted @ 2023-05-23 17:15  HoFei1113  阅读(39)  评论(0编辑  收藏  举报